Top 5 Tips for a Seamless Facilities Management Mobilisation

A seamless mobilisation is the bedrock of a successful facilities management contract. It sets the tone for the entire partnership and lays the groundwork for long-term operational excellence. This post provides five top tips to help you navigate the complexities of mobilisation and ensure a smooth transition from day one.
1. Conduct Comprehensive Due Diligence
Before you do anything else, gain a deep understanding of the client’s assets, culture, and expectations. A thorough due diligence process prevents nasty surprises down the line. Walk the site, review existing documentation, and talk to the people on the ground. The more you know, the smoother the transition will be.
2. Establish Crystal-Clear Communication
Communication is king in mobilisation. Develop a clear communication plan that outlines who needs to be informed, about what, and how often. Regular meetings with clients, team members, and suppliers will ensure everyone is aligned and that issues are addressed proactively.
3. Build Your A-Team
Your team is your greatest asset. Ensure you have the right people with the right skills and, most importantly, the right attitude. Invest in training and empower your team to take ownership of their roles. A motivated and well-prepared team is unstoppable.
4. Leverage Technology from the Start
Don’t wait to implement technology. Use a CAFM system or other digital tools from the very beginning to manage assets, schedule work, and track performance. This not only improves efficiency but also provides valuable data for future transformation initiatives.
5. Plan for Stabilisation
The job isn’t done when the contract goes live. Plan for a stabilisation period (e.g., the first 30-90 days) to address teething issues, fine-tune processes, and ensure the operation is running smoothly. This shows the client you are committed to their long-term success.
